Tips for Seamless Moving of Small Furniture Over Long Distances
When planning a long-distance move, especially for heavy or bulky items like furniture, it’s crucial to have a strategy in place for a seamless transition. For small furniture, careful disassembly and proper packing are key. Start by removing all drawers and doors, and wrap each piece individually with bubble wrap or specialized moving blankets for protection during transit. Disassemble any additional parts that can be safely detached, such as legs or shelves, and label these components clearly to ensure easy reassembly.
Optimal packaging materials make a world of difference in safeguarding your furniture during long-distance travel. Use sturdy boxes, padding, and tape to secure each item. For larger pieces, consider investing in custom crating services that provide an extra layer of protection. Additionally, measure the dimensions of both the furniture and the moving vehicle to ensure a safe fit, minimizing the risk of damage during loading and unloading.
